Western Settlers Harrisburg, Pennsylvania
Lo-Fi indie folk artist from Reading, PA, western settlers is singer-songwriter Alex Kablack with other occasional
contributors.
A lofty ride in a warm atmosphere of harmonics and growling vocals, striking a balance somewhere between west coast indie folk and alternative country
